软件网络监控如何提高监控数据的准确性?

在当今信息化时代,软件网络监控已经成为企业保障网络安全、提高业务效率的重要手段。然而,如何提高监控数据的准确性,成为了众多企业面临的一大挑战。本文将深入探讨软件网络监控如何提高监控数据的准确性,以期为相关企业提供有益的参考。

一、明确监控目标与范围

明确监控目标是提高监控数据准确性的首要任务。企业应根据自身业务需求,确定需要监控的网络设备、应用系统、用户行为等,从而确保监控数据的全面性和针对性。

确定监控范围同样重要。企业需根据实际业务场景,合理划分监控区域,避免过度监控或监控盲区。例如,企业可以将内部办公网络与生产网络进行分离,分别进行监控,以提高监控数据的准确性。

二、选用合适的监控工具

选用合适的监控工具是提高监控数据准确性的关键。以下是一些值得推荐的监控工具:

  1. 开源监控工具:如Nagios、Zabbix等,具有丰富的功能、良好的扩展性和较低的成本。
  2. 商业监控工具:如SolarWinds、Nitorio等,提供专业的技术支持和丰富的功能模块,适用于大型企业。
  3. 定制化监控工具:针对企业特殊需求,开发定制化的监控工具,确保监控数据的准确性。

在选择监控工具时,企业应考虑以下因素:

  1. 功能需求:确保监控工具具备所需的功能,如流量监控、性能监控、安全监控等。
  2. 性能指标:选择性能稳定、响应速度快的监控工具。
  3. 易用性:选择操作简单、易于维护的监控工具。

三、建立完善的监控指标体系

建立完善的监控指标体系是提高监控数据准确性的重要保障。企业应根据自身业务需求,制定合理的监控指标,如:

  1. 网络流量:实时监控网络流量,识别异常流量,防范网络攻击。
  2. 服务器性能:监控服务器CPU、内存、磁盘等资源使用情况,确保服务器稳定运行。
  3. 应用性能:监控应用系统运行状态,发现性能瓶颈,提高用户体验。
  4. 安全事件:实时监控安全事件,及时发现并处理安全威胁。

在建立监控指标体系时,企业应注意以下几点:

  1. 指标全面性:确保监控指标涵盖业务需求,避免遗漏重要信息。
  2. 指标合理性:监控指标应具有可量化的标准,便于数据分析和决策。
  3. 指标动态调整:根据业务发展和监控需求,适时调整监控指标。

四、加强监控数据分析

加强监控数据分析是提高监控数据准确性的关键环节。企业应建立专业的数据分析团队,对监控数据进行深度挖掘,从而发现潜在问题,为业务决策提供有力支持。

以下是一些数据分析方法:

  1. 数据可视化:将监控数据以图表、图形等形式展示,便于直观分析。
  2. 趋势分析:分析监控数据趋势,预测未来发展趋势。
  3. 异常检测:识别异常数据,发现潜在问题。

在数据分析过程中,企业应注意以下几点:

  1. 数据质量:确保监控数据准确、完整。
  2. 分析方法:选择合适的分析方法,提高数据分析的准确性。
  3. 数据共享:将分析结果与相关部门共享,共同推动业务发展。

五、案例分析

以下是一个关于软件网络监控提高监控数据准确性的案例分析:

案例背景:某企业拥有多个分支机构,网络环境复杂,监控数据准确性较低,导致网络安全问题频发。

解决方案

  1. 明确监控目标与范围:根据企业业务需求,确定需要监控的网络设备、应用系统、用户行为等,合理划分监控区域。
  2. 选用合适的监控工具:选择具有丰富功能、稳定性能、易用性的商业监控工具,如Nitorio。
  3. 建立完善的监控指标体系:制定合理的监控指标,如网络流量、服务器性能、应用性能、安全事件等。
  4. 加强监控数据分析:建立专业的数据分析团队,对监控数据进行深度挖掘,发现潜在问题。

实施效果:通过实施上述方案,企业监控数据准确性显著提高,网络安全问题得到有效控制,业务发展得到有力保障。

总结

提高软件网络监控数据的准确性,需要企业从多个方面进行努力。通过明确监控目标与范围、选用合适的监控工具、建立完善的监控指标体系、加强监控数据分析等措施,企业可以有效提高监控数据的准确性,为业务发展提供有力保障。

猜你喜欢:云原生可观测性